commit fe39f982eaa199350f3ca972ac82ec7a493fd74d Author: Lukian Date: Thu Jan 23 13:20:56 2025 +0100 First commit diff --git a/Affichage_lettre.lua b/Affichage_lettre.lua new file mode 100644 index 0000000..8cc6555 --- /dev/null +++ b/Affichage_lettre.lua @@ -0,0 +1,20 @@ +mqtt.client("100", "mqtt.leizoour.fr", 8883, true) +client:connect("student", "O99Rq8$F12NXzhL5caya") + +-- CLK (clock) : D19 +-- DT (data) : D21 +-- SW (Bouton): D23 +-- dir = direction de tournage de l'encodeur +-- counter = nombre de cran tourner +-- button = bouton poussoir + +function action(dir, counter, button) + cls() + lettre = string.char((counter % 26)+97) + --if button==1 then + console("Le lettre") + console("choisie est : "..lettre) +end + +enc = encoder.attach(pio.GPIO19,pio.GPIO21,pio.GPIO23,action) +